Kennedy stood at her window, her eyes wide with excitement. Today was the day she would become a true potty champion. "I'm ready to say goodbye to diapers!" she declared, her voice filled with determination. Brown the Dog wagged his tail enthusiastically, his big eyes full of encouragement. Rags the Lamb leaped beside him, her soft wool bouncing with every jump. "Let's make this journey fun!" she cheered.
Kennedy looked at the potty, a mix of curiosity and hesitation in her eyes. Brown barked encouragingly, "Remember, Kennedy, pooping in the potty is the first step to becoming a big kid!"
"But what if I can't do it?" Kennedy asked, a hint of doubt creeping into her voice.
Rags pranced around her feet, "Don't worry! We'll be with you every step of the way. Let's turn those jitters into giggles!"
Kennedy marched forward, her friends by her side. Along the way, they met Captain Potty Pants, a wise old turtle with a shell decorated with toilet paper patterns. "Ahoy, young trainers! Fear not, for every step brings you closer to victory!" "Thanks, Captain Potty Pants!" Kennedy giggled, feeling a surge of confidence.
Kennedy approached the potty with newfound courage. Brown and Rags watched with eager eyes. "Here goes nothing!" she said, determination in her voice.
With a triumphant smile, she accomplished her mission. The room erupted in joyful applause as Brown barked and Rags danced.
"We did it!" Kennedy exclaimed, twirling with delight. Captain Potty Pants joined the celebration, tapping his feet with joy. "Another champion rises in Pottyville!" he cheered. Brown and Rags high-fived each other. "Kennedy, you're the best potty pro we know!"
Kennedy lay back with a content sigh. Brown curled up beside her, and Rags nuzzled close. "Thanks, friends. I couldn't have done it without you." "It's always more fun with friends," Brown said, his tail wagging. "And remember," Rags added, "being a potty pro is the best superpower of all." As the stars twinkled above, Kennedy drifted into dreams of more adventures, her heart full of big-kid pride.
